- The distance between Hama, Syria and Mount Pleasant, Mi, Usa is approximately 9,434 km or 5,862 mi.
- To reach Hama in this distance one would set out from Mount Pleasant, Mi bearing 44.3° or NE and follow the great circles arc to approach Hama bearing 142.1° or SE .
- Hama has a Mediterranean hot climate (Csa) whereas Mount Pleasant, Mi has a warm summer continental/ hemiboreal climate with no dry season (Dfb).
- Hama is in or near the subtropical thorn woodland biome whereas Mount Pleasant, Mi is in or near the cool temperate moist forest biome.
- The mean temperature is 9.9 °C (17.8°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 6.6 °C (11.9°F) less in Hama. The continentality subtype is subcontinental as opposed to truly continental.
- Total annual precipitation averages 432 mm (17 in) less which is equivalent to 432 l/m² (10.6 US gal/ft²) or 4,320,000 l/ha (461,837 US gal/ac) less. About 4/9 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 8.9° higher in Hama than in Mount Pleasant, Mi.
